Hello, apologies in advance for the random email but I’m a massive fan of your work. I aspire to be a badass creative professional like you and think I could reach that level one day with the proper guidance. Can I buy you coffee and pick your brain?

Hey! I’m not sure if my first email conveyed how excited I am about potentially picking that big ole brain of yours! I can’t wait to learn what makes you tick and any tips to get the creativity flowing. (Plus, I would love some tips on how to make my Instagram cooler, too.) I mean, my own content is pretty good, but yours is straight up next level. Are you free on later this week, maybe on Thursday?

I hope this isn’t asking too much, but I’m actually attaching a marketing presentation that I would love your feedback on. It’d be really rad if you could check it out when you get a chance (seriously, no rush!) and let me know what you think. It’s a work-in-progress, but we can chat more when I’m picking your brain and enjoying a hot cup of joe. Unless you prefer it, iced? Someone once told me cold brew is actually better for creativity.

Just following up from earlier this morning. I think the file was too large to attach so here is a download link. (It expires in 30 minutes so please click it ASAP!) Really curious to see what you think of my ideas! Are the fonts I am using cool enough? Seriously, though, feel free to give precise and exact feedback on what I can do to make the work more like yours.

Ugh, sorry! Just made a couple of revisions to the presentation since I sent it to you: on page seven to 13, page 17, and pages 22 to 29. I’m including a brand-new download link for you here. I re-designed all the title slides feel more like something Barbara Kruger would have done. Please disregard the old version, especially if you saw the slides that said “Insert Ideas From Brain Pick Session” here. That wasn’t a reference to you at all.

So, I just heard back from my boss on that PDF I had sent you. He wants me to “push things further” and also to see one Instagram-centric activation idea. Do you have any suggestions on how I can push things? It’d also be great if you had an idea or two that work for Instagram lying around in that brain of yours.

Who am I kidding? You’re so much better at this than I am. Do you think you could hop into the presentation document directly and just make these changes real quick per all the notes? (Throw in that Instagram idea, too.) Just save out a new version as “client_presentation_final.” But honestly, I can’t wait to pick your brain!
